What will the store of the future now look like?

Looks at the new considerations for tomorrow's store with the health crisis changing all the existing rules of physical retailing.

Retailers were already asking questions about how stores should look and function in a digital age. But with the health crisis changing all the existing rules of physical retailing, what will be the new considerations for tomorrow’s store? Xian Wang, Global Content Director at Edge by Ascential highlights some of the critical questions to consider.
